Jacob Tobey Leaves Spurs Booth After Affair Allegation

Jacob Tobey will not return as the San Antonio Spurs’ play-by-play announcer after an affair allegation spread across social media.

The move marks an abrupt change for a visible broadcast role tied to one of the NBA’s most followed teams. Front Office Sports reported that Tobey is out after the allegation surfaced in a viral post.

What happened

Tobey had been in the Spurs’ broadcast chair, but the latest development means he will not be back in that position. The allegation itself became the central issue after gaining traction online.

Why it stands out

Broadcast jobs around major sports teams rarely become public conversation unless there is a sudden personnel shift. In this case, the allegation moved the situation from a private matter into a widely discussed change to the Spurs’ game coverage.

Front Office Sports reported the development on July 9, and the update indicated that Tobey would not return to the announcer role. The article did not provide additional details about the allegation beyond the social media post that brought it attention.
